Transaction

dbb6d56d1a3ee4ec66ee8ae61bc779a2c73029830098bdc0cf4e71af96022da6
147,853 confirmations
Timestamp
1685542240
Block792,261
Fee11,323 sats
Fee rate68.6 sats/vB
view on mempool.space

Inputs & Outputs